9. Pet Food Scoops or Treat Holders

Cut the container into a scoop or just use it whole to store treats, kibble, or pet waste bags. It’s clean, reusable, and saves you from having to buy more plastic.


10. Compost Scraps Collector

Keep one on your kitchen counter or under the sink as a temporary compost bin for vegetable peels, coffee grounds, and eggshells. It’s a mess-free way to collect scraps before transferring them to your outdoor compost pile.


Bonus Tip: Label and Stack

Use a marker or some washi tape to label each container by its new purpose. Stack them in a drawer or storage bin for easy access and a clutter-free home.
